Bước 1: Thiết lập Java
Khi bạn viết các ứng dụng Android, bạn thường viết themin mã nguồn Java. Rằng
mã nguồn Java sau đó được biến thành những thứ mà Android thực sự chạy (Dalvik
bytecode trong một gói phần mềm Android [apk] tập tin).
Do đó, điều đầu tiên bạn cần làm là có được thiết lập với một môi trường phát triển Java
để bạn được chuẩn bị để bắt đầu viết các lớp Java.
Cài đặt JDK
, bạn cần để có được và cài đặt chính thức của Oracle Java SEDevelopment Kit (JDK). Bạn
có thể có được điều này từ trang web Oracle Java cho Windows và Linux, và từ Apple
cho Mac OS X. JDK đồng bằng (sans bất kỳ "bó") là đủ. Thực hiện theo các hướng dẫn
được cung cấp bởi Oracle hoặc Apple để cài đặt nó trên máy tính của bạn. Atthe thời điểm này,
Android hỗ trợ Java 5 và Java 6, với Java 7 có khả năng được hỗ trợ bởi thời gian bạn
đang đọc này.
2
www.it-ebooks.info
Chương 2: Làm thế nào để bắt đầu 8
KHÁC JAVA trình biên dịch
Về nguyên tắc , bạn có nghĩa vụ phải sử dụng chính thức của Oracle JDK. Trong thực tế, có vẻ như OpenJDK cũng
hoạt động, ít nhất là trên Ubuntu. Tuy nhiên, hơn nữa removedyou nhận được từ việc thực hiện chính thức của Oracle,
ít có khả năng nó là nó sẽ làm việc. Ví dụ, trình biên dịch GNU cho Java (GCJ) có thể không làm việc với
Android.
Tìm hiểu Java
cuốn sách này, giống như hầu hết các sách và tài liệu trên Android, giả định rằng bạn có
kinh nghiệm lập trình Java cơ bản. Nếu bạn thiếu điều này, bạn thực sự nên xem xét
chi tiêu một chút thời gian trước khi bạn Javafundamentals diveinto Android. Nếu không,
. bạn có thể tìm thấy những kinh nghiệm để được bực bội
Nếu bạn đang cần một khóa học sụp đổ trong Java để tham gia vào phát triển Android, đây
là những khái niệm bạn cần phải học, trình bày không theo thứ tự đặc biệt:
? Ngôn ngữ cơ bản (điều khiển lưu lượng, vv)
? Các lớp học và các đối tượng
? Phương pháp và các thành viên dữ liệu
? Công cộng, tư nhân, và được bảo vệ
? Tĩnh và dụ phạm vi
? Trường hợp ngoại lệ
? Chủ đề và đồng thời kiểm soát
? Bộ sưu tập
? Generics
? Tập tin I / O
? Phản ánh
? Giao diện
Một trong những cách dễ nhất để có được kiến thức này là để đọc Tìm hiểu Java cho Android
Developmentby Jeff Friesen (Apress, 2010
đang được dịch, vui lòng đợi..